What you can expect

On a guided walking tour, learn about Cologne's rich history that dates as far back as 2000 years ago.
Explore Cologne's oldest street, Hohe Straße, and learn about the rich history of the quarter surrounding it. Admire the breweries, traditional pubs, monastries, churches, and carnival clubs along the tour.
Admire Cologne's medieval City Wall and catch a glimpse of what Cologne looked like in 1180. Also, take a moment to see the Basilica of St. Severin, an early Romanesque basilica church established in the late 14th century.
Along the tour, see the many big traditional carnival clubs and fountains in the city. End at Severinstorburg, one of the four surviving city gates from the Middle Ages. Today, the big carnival parade begins here, but it was once how kings and nobles entered Cologne.
